Savage Surge

Instant1 generic manaGreen mana

A straight +2/+2 at instant speed is the genre's most worn-out effect; the rider that follows it is what gives this spell a second job. Untapping the target turns a combat trick into a surprise blocker: cast it on a creature you have already attacked with this turn, and that tapped body can suddenly hold the line on the way back, covering both halves of the turn at once. The same untap untangles activated abilities that require tapping, letting a creature produce its tap effect, get pumped, then untap to use it again the same turn, which is where green's more contrived lines find a use for it. That second function is the card's real design seam. The +2/+2 sells it as a trick, but the untap is what lets it pull double duty as a single-target tap-untap engine, the kind of repetition green usually reserves for board-wide effects. It is narrow by green's standards, asking for a board state where one creature being available twice in a turn actually changes the math, but within that window it does something most pump spells cannot. The cost of that flexibility is that neither half is large: +2/+2 wins few fights it would have lost, and the untap matters only when you have a specific reuse already lined up. Walk into the turn knowing which of its two jobs you are buying, or the spell underdelivers on both.

Oracle Text

Rules text

Target creature gets +2/+2 until end of turn. Untap that creature.
